What are Web App Development Platforms for Jira Work Management?

Web app development platforms provide the tools and frameworks needed to design, develop, test, and deploy web applications. These platforms often include integrated development environments (IDEs), pre-built templates, code libraries, and drag-and-drop components that simplify the development process. Web app development platforms support various programming languages, databases, and APIs, allowing developers to build scalable, secure, and interactive web applications. By using these platforms, developers can streamline the app development lifecycle, enhance productivity, and reduce time-to-market for web-based applications.
